Vorschrift
1-Bromo-2-(2-bromo-1,1,2,2-tetrafluoroethoxy)-3-fluorobenzene (14 g, 38 mmol), copper powder (12.2 g, 192 mmol) and 2,2′-bipyridine (610 mg, 3.9 mmol) were combined in dry DMSO (55 mL) and heated to 150° C. for 1.5 h. Vacuum (ca 20 mm) was applied to the reactor and distillate was taken overhead until the pot temperature reached 100° C. The distillate containing the product and DMSO was diluted with 1:1 diethyl ether-pentane (30 mL) and washed (3×5 mL) with water, dried, and distilled at 1 atmosphere (atm) through a 200 mm Vigreux column to remove the bulk of the solvents. Vacuum (ca 20 mmHg) was applied and the fraction boiling at 60-65° C. was collected to afford the title compound as a clear liquid (5.1 g, 64%): 1H NMR (400 MHz, CDCl3) δ 7.40-7.31 (m, 2H), 7.25-7.17 (m, 1H); EIMS m/z 210.
